当前位置:首页 > 综合资讯 > 正文
广告招租
游戏推广

java云服务器开发,Java云服务器环境搭建指南,从入门到精通,助你轻松构建高性能Java应用

java云服务器开发,Java云服务器环境搭建指南,从入门到精通,助你轻松构建高性能Java应用

本指南从入门到精通,详细介绍了Java云服务器开发与搭建,涵盖环境配置、性能优化等关键环节,助您轻松构建高性能Java应用。...

本指南从入门到精通,详细介绍了java云服务器开发与搭建,涵盖环境配置、性能优化等关键环节,助您轻松构建高性能Java应用。

随着互联网的快速发展,Java作为一门成熟、稳定、跨平台的编程语言,被广泛应用于企业级应用开发,云服务器因其高可用性、高扩展性、低成本等优势,成为Java应用部署的首选环境,本文将为您详细讲解Java云服务器环境搭建的步骤,助您轻松构建高性能Java应用。

java云服务器开发,Java云服务器环境搭建指南,从入门到精通,助你轻松构建高性能Java应用

环境准备

1、云服务器:选择一款适合Java应用的云服务器,如阿里云、腾讯云、华为云等,以下以阿里云为例。

2、操作系统:推荐使用Linux系统,如CentOS 7、Ubuntu 18.04等。

3、Java开发环境:JDK 1.8及以上版本。

4、数据库:根据实际需求选择合适的数据库,如MySQL、Oracle、MongoDB等。

5、Web服务器:如Tomcat、Jetty、Jboss等。

环境搭建步骤

1、创建云服务器

登录云服务平台,创建一台云服务器,选择合适的实例规格、地域、可用区、镜像等。

2、配置云服务器

(1)设置密码:在创建云服务器时,设置一个复杂的密码,确保安全。

(2)SSH连接:使用SSH客户端(如PuTTY)连接到云服务器。

(3)安装SSH密钥:将本地生成的SSH密钥导入云服务器,实现免密码登录。

java云服务器开发,Java云服务器环境搭建指南,从入门到精通,助你轻松构建高性能Java应用

3、安装操作系统

(1)使用SSH连接到云服务器后,执行以下命令安装操作系统:

sudo yum install -y centos-release
sudo yum install -y centos-release-minimal
sudo yum install -y yum-utils
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o yum install -y docker-ce docker-ce-cli containerd.io
sudo systemctl start docker
sudo systemctl enable docker

(2)根据提示选择合适的安装源,然后执行以下命令安装操作系统:

sudo yum install -y https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/centos-release-7-2009.x86_64.rpm
sudo yum install -y https://mirrors.aliyun.com/centos/7/os/x86_64/Packages/centos-release-minimal-7-2009.x86_64.rpm
sudo yum install -y yum-utils
s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o
sudo yum install -y docker-ce docker-ce-cli containerd.io
sudo systemctl start docker
sudo systemctl enable docker

4、安装Java开发环境

(1)下载JDK:前往Oracle官网下载JDK安装包,选择合适的版本。

(2)安装JDK:

sudo yum install -y java-1.8.0-openjdk java-1.8.0-openjdk-devel

(3)配置环境变量:

export JAVA_HOME=/usr/lib/jvm/java-1.8.0-openjdk-1.8.0.272.x86_64
export PATH=$JAVA_HOME/bin:$PATH

5、安装数据库

以MySQL为例,执行以下命令安装:

sudo yum install -y mysql-community-server
sudo systemctl start mysqld
sudo systemctl enable mysqld

(1)设置root密码:

sudo mysql_secure_installation

(2)配置MySQL远程访问:

java云服务器开发,Java云服务器环境搭建指南,从入门到精通,助你轻松构建高性能Java应用

sudo vi /etc/my.cnf

在[mysqld]部分添加以下内容:

bind-address=0.0.0.0

重启MySQL服务:

sudo systemctl restart mysqld

6、安装Web服务器

以Tomcat为例,执行以下命令安装:

sudo yum install -y tomcat
sudo systemctl start tomcat
sudo systemctl enable tomcat

7、部署Java应用

(1)将Java应用源码上传到云服务器。

(2)解压源码包。

(3)配置Web服务器,如Tomcat,将应用部署到Web服务器。

(4)启动Web服务器,访问应用。

本文详细讲解了Java云服务器环境搭建的步骤,包括创建云服务器、配置操作系统、安装Java开发环境、数据库、Web服务器等,通过本文的指导,您将能够轻松构建高性能的Java应用,为您的业务发展提供有力支持,在实际操作过程中,请根据实际需求进行调整,祝您搭建成功!

广告招租
游戏推广

发表评论

最新文章